In this Tips and Tricks article, we explain how to determine the perfect settings for processing Trotec laminates. We also provide the tried-and-tested laser settings for this material.
Trotec's laminate collection can be used to create high-quality signage without the need for printing. As the laser beam engraves the material's top layer, a contrasting substrate is revealed. This results in highly visible text and images.
Moreover, TroLase is ideal for name tag, display stand, and wall décor applications.
Dual-toned stickers can be crafted by kiss cutting TroLase Foils. This technique involves narrowly cutting the top layer of the foil so that the substrate is left untouched. As a result, the foil is marked and its adhesive properties are not diminished.
In effect, the material's top layer is "kissed" by the laser beam, allowing the sticker to be peeled cleanly.
To properly prepare your laser for processing laminates, we recommend that you use either the Aluminum Cutting Grid Table or the Aluminum Slat Cutting Table.
After placing your material on the laser bed, cover the remaining space to maximize the system's vacuum suction power. This trick will ensure that the laminate workpiece stays in place when being cut or engraved.
It is recommended that you engrave workpieces from bottom to top because an exhaust mechanism is situated at the back of the laser. As the laser heard moves towards the back of the laser bed, areas that have already been processed are cleared of debris that can cause discolouration. This tip is particularly important for processing laminates that have a light substrate and a significantly darker top layer.
It is imperative to pick the right graphic resolution in order to obtain the best results. The specific image used and the processing time are crucial. When working with TroLase, it is recommended that you use a moderate resolution (500 dpi). This will allow for finer details to be engraved onto your workpiece. However, it is also important to remember that the higher the resolution, the longer the processing time.
Our experts recommend using a 2" lens when working with laminates. This specific lens is particularly versatile: its focal length is wide enough to cut thicker laminates, yet it is still thin enough to engrave minute details.
Hence, with a 2" lens, you are able to create small and intricate details on your workpiece, and engrave larger surfaces with precision.
A nozzle with large hole diameter will create a weaker Air Assist stream, which prevents engraved TroLase from cooling to quickly. When the Air Assist settings are too strong, your design will have a light grey colour. Nevertheless, a moderate airflow is necessary to prevent debris from reaching, and potentially damaging, the lens.
When engraving large TroLase workpieces, you can generally achieve better results by de-focusing the laser. To achieve definition in your designs, a z-offset of between 2 and 7 mm is recommended (depending on the laser power and machine resolution). De-focusing the laser beam reduces the formation of grooves, creating a smoother engraving finish.
The specific lens used is also important. It is advised that you use a lens with a greater focal length to engrave larger laminate workpieces. When it comes to very intricate details (e.g., 4 pt font), we do not recommend using a z-offset.
Given that your cutting and engraving settings are optimized, minimal cleaning is required after processing TroLase. Typically, only a damp cloth is needed because there is very little residue. An alcohol-free cleaner can be applied to the laminate if there is more debris than expected.
